Output 22aa949a55b91ba69ced322c32ad2c1a5ed212558f548338f5f56c90f6ea3fdf:18

value
29755655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46df93efa4eb81124240876f785d8208fac34af9 OP_EQUAL
address
MEMuNKbaQb1rDHEPq4czDB2hQxBjbxAuFV
transaction
22aa949a55b91ba69ced322c32ad2c1a5ed212558f548338f5f56c90f6ea3fdf
spent
true